Thieves steal $20,000 worth of trading cards from Sangamon County store
Share and Follow


A significant theft in Sangamon County has prompted local law enforcement to reach out to the community for assistance.

The incident took place early last Thursday morning, shortly after 5 a.m., at the 217Comics and Games store in Laketown Township, just a short distance from Springfield.
